Marex is a global financial services platform, providing essential liquidity, market access and infrastructure services to clients in the energy, commodities and financial markets.

The Group provides comprehensive breadth and depth of coverage across four core services: Market Making, Clearing, Hedging and Investment Solutions and Agency and Execution. It has a major franchise in many major metals, energy and agricultural products, executing around 50 million trades and clearing 205 million contracts in 2022. The Group provides access to the world’s major commodity markets, covering a broad range of clients that include some of the largest commodity producers, consumers and traders, banks, hedge funds and asset managers.

With more than 35 offices around the globe, and over 2,300 dedicated people enabling access to exchanges and technology-powered services.

Purpose of Role:

The purpose of the Senior Futures Brokerage Analyst role is to assist in ensuring the accuracy of the firm’s Give Up Receivables and Payables and to help improve the turnaround time of these amounts. Manage processes AP/AR in both CME Give Up Payment System (GPS) and FIA Tech Atlantis payment systems. Asist with Aged Collection.

Responsibilities:

  • Reconcile the firm’s execution Billing System, People Soft (PS) to amounts settled in the Give Up Payment System (GPS) and FIA-Tech Atlantis.
  • Manage aged debt collection efforts for the U.S. entities.
  • Verify trades for payment, allocate payments for coding in People Soft (PS).
  • Generate manual invoices for execution business.
  • Review existing departmental policies and procedures, and institute updates where needed.
  • Assist the team with the various ongoing audits (Internal, Regulatory, External) by compiling requested information on a timely basis and communicating responses in a prompt and effective manner.
  • Ensuring compliance with the company’s regulatory requirements under the SEC, FINRA, NFA, CFTC and other applicable exchanges.
